

The challenge was to ensure that all sheet metal parts met the required tolerances before they left the factory. The traditional measurement room approach was not providing the necessary process reliability. The need was for a solution that could inspect 100% of the parts quickly and accurately, ensuring that only quality parts were delivered to the OEMs.
Eleven Dynamics AG stepped in with a solution. They presented a Proof of Concept (POC) of a digital twin of a measurement cell at Magna Steyr. This digital twin, powered by Nexos 4.0 software, was capable of simulating and managing automated measurement processes.
The solution was flexible and adaptable, designed to meet Magna Steyr's specific needs. It could support any robot, sensor, and cell configuration, making it a perfect fit for the diverse range of sheet metal parts that Magna Steyr produced.
The results were immediate and impressive. All parts could be checked within the digital twin in just a few minutes, ensuring 100% control. The solution improved process reliability, increased throughput, and provided high-quality measurement data.
The POC demonstrated the added value of the solution in real-time, convincing Magna Steyr of its effectiveness. The solution integrated seamlessly with existing systems at Magna Steyr, including KUKA robots, POLYWORKS software, and the LEICA AS1 scanner.
